Cartoonist Kishore gets bail

Cartoonist Ahmed Kabir Kishore has secured six-month bail in a case filed against him under Digital Security Act (DSA).

The High Court bench of Justice M Enayetur Rahim and Justice Md Mostafizur Rahman accepted his bail plea on Wednesday (March 3).

Earlier on March 1, the HC bench set today for passing its order on the bail petition.

Barrister Jyotirmoy Barua stood for Kishore while Deputy Attorney General Sarwar Hossain Bappi represented the state during the hearing in the court.

On May 5, 2020, Rapid Action Battalion (RAB) filed the case against 11 people on charges of spreading anti-state falsehood to tarnish the image of Bangladesh and create confusion from a Facebook page.

The 11 accused in the case are Ahmed Kabir Kishore, Rashtrachinta coordinator Didarul Bhuiyan, Minhaj Mannan, Tasnim Khalil, Sahed Alam, Asif Mohiuddin, Zulkarnain Khan alias Sami, Ashik Imran, Swapan Wahid, Philip Shumakher and writer Mushtak Ahmed, who died in jail recently.

Earlier on January 13, police filed the charge-sheet against cartoonist Ahmed Kabir Kishore, Rashtrachinta coordinator Didarul Bhuiyan and writer Mushtak Ahmed.

Police, however, dropped names of eight accused including Zulkarnain Khan alias Sami from the charge-sheet, saying the allegations brought against them have not been proved.

On February 10, Bangladesh Cyber Tribunal had ordered Counter Terrorism and Transnational Crimes (CTTC) unit of the police to further investigate the case and submit the report.
